- [ ] Step 7: Archive cold storage buckets (Glacierline tier). Confirm both ceremony witnesses are present, verify bucket manifests match the Oxbow ledger, then seal the archive key shares. Plugin authors may observe but not handle shares. Once sealed, the archive index itself is encrypted and can only be reopened with the passphrase below.

vault phrase of badup-hahig = tamael-aldael-kelmir-istael-fenok-istwyn-tamius-jorath-oliion

# Break-Glass: Linkway Deep-Link Router

If Linkway (the deep-link routing service for the Pondermill apps) starts bouncing users to the fallback web view and the config console is unreachable, you're in break-glass territory. Don't panic — this happens maybe twice a year. Grab the emergency admin role via the Ops Hatch tool, flip the router to static-map mode, and page the routing squad afterward. The Ops Hatch unlock requires the standing recovery passphrase, which for on-call convenience is recorded directly below this line.

unlock words, yawig-kagef: gordor-holvan-ulaael-pramir-ulaiel-tamdor

MEMO — Support Outsourcing Plan

Branch managers, quick heads-up: we're moving tier-one customer support for the Pellwick product family to Corvane Services starting next quarter. Your teams keep handling escalations and anything billing-related, so nothing changes on that front. Expect a short transition period with longer response times — please keep customers in the loop and log any rough patches in the usual tracker. Training sessions run the week after next. The wider business context is captured in the confidential note below.

internal memo for hahif-hahaf: Headcount on the Zorwyn team goes from 9 to 100 by the end of October. Gross margin on Zorwyn came in at 5 percent against a plan of 10 percent.

## Onboarding — Markdown Pipeline (Inkmere)

Inkmere docs render through a three-stage pipeline: parse, sanitize, emit. Releases rebuild all templates; never hot-patch emitted HTML. Broken renders usually mean a sanitizer rule change — check the rules diff first. The render cluster only accepts builds from the release channel, and every build artifact must be signed before upload. Sign artifacts with the deploy key below.

release key, hafop-tajef: bky13_s2vaFVNJTHfBL